      <description>&lt;P&gt;A suggestion is to put your data in a different format. Here is the walk through.&lt;/P&gt;
&lt;P&gt;Here is the data&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_0-1692202495134.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55800i7CA9650282FAC1A8/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_0-1692202495134.png" alt="peng_liu_0-1692202495134.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Then "stack" your X variables. Check out menu item "Stack" Under "Tables". In the dialog, uncheck "Stack by Row", check "Drop All" as indicated in the following screenshot.&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_1-1692202576926.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55801i2DC9E17276CB4B9D/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_1-1692202576926.png" alt="peng_liu_1-1692202576926.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Then you get this:&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_2-1692202668587.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55802i530D1D815A20E7CA/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_2-1692202668587.png" alt="peng_liu_2-1692202668587.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Do the same on your Y variables and you get this:&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_3-1692202712887.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55803iED12911D05D7B12D/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_3-1692202712887.png" alt="peng_liu_3-1692202712887.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Now, you put them side by side. A copy-n-paste will do. And rename the columns. Get this:&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_4-1692202797991.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55804iF137EDDD5AAAF306/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_4-1692202797991.png" alt="peng_liu_4-1692202797991.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Now fit your regressions by Label:&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_5-1692202833988.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55805i1559E70BD10777DA/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_5-1692202833988.png" alt="peng_liu_5-1692202833988.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;When you do the fit, remember to hold the Control key when you click menu. This will fit model to all By-groups.&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_6-1692202977432.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55806i3A14AFA88669901A/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_6-1692202977432.png" alt="peng_liu_6-1692202977432.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Now right click on the interested number, select Make Combined Data Table.&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="peng_liu_7-1692203063336.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55807i660A1A2A749C673A/image-size/medium?v=v2&amp;amp;px=400" role="button" title="peng_liu_7-1692203063336.png" alt="peng_liu_7-1692203063336.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Now you should have a bunch of numbers in the generated table, but in an organized way. You can select, subset to get what you want.&lt;/P&gt;

      <description>&lt;P&gt;&lt;a href="https://community.jmp.com/t5/user/viewprofilepage/user-id/49314"&gt;@daily_learn&lt;/a&gt;&amp;nbsp;: In addition to all of those great ideas, you could use the Multivariate platform: Just put in all your Xs and Ys, then take a look at the "Pairwise Correlations" report. The R^2 values can be generated by squaring those correlations: right-mouse click on the Pairwise Correlations output and choose "Make in to Data Table". Then, add a column that is the Correlation squared.&lt;/P&gt;&lt;P&gt;Then Just keep the ones of interest.&lt;/P&gt;</description>

      <description>&lt;P&gt;How I would approach this, is to use&amp;nbsp;&lt;/P&gt;
&lt;P&gt;&amp;nbsp; &amp;nbsp; &amp;nbsp;Analyze=&amp;gt;Screening=&amp;gt;Response Screening&lt;/P&gt;
&lt;P&gt;This will allow you to select the pairwise analyses you want&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_0-1692550302672.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55872i8A213CDA8F6621C7/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_0-1692550302672.png" alt="txnelson_0-1692550302672.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;The platform creates a Pvalues table, which you can easily plot the pairs of X and Y columns using Graph Builder,. and specifying RSquare as the Color column.&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_1-1692550584067.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55873iD841CEE9C36443E3/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_1-1692550584067.png" alt="txnelson_1-1692550584067.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;The order can easily be changed by setting the Value Order column property&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_2-1692550787363.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55874i1C447A4A97C2E0E0/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_2-1692550787363.png" alt="txnelson_2-1692550787363.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;Which when the Apply button is pressed, the graph is changed to:&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_3-1692550848157.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55875iB7A9B33A275B0BAA/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_3-1692550848157.png" alt="txnelson_3-1692550848157.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;The Bivariate plots are also available.&amp;nbsp; By selecting 1, 2, ......n rows in the Pvalues data table, and then clicking on the embedded script, "Fit Selected Items"&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_4-1692551039049.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55876i6A2F5F7A9FBE387C/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_4-1692551039049.png" alt="txnelson_4-1692551039049.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;A window will be displayed with all of the Bivariate plots within it.&lt;/P&gt;
&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per lia-image-align-inline" image-alt="txnelson_5-1692551128791.png" style="width: 400px;"&gt;&lt;img src="https://community.jmp.com/t5/image/serverpage/image-id/55877iB25DFD0AB4F8E6E2/image-size/medium?v=v2&amp;amp;px=400" role="button" title="txnelson_5-1692551128791.png" alt="txnelson_5-1692551128791.png" /&gt;&lt;/span&gt;&lt;/P&gt;
&lt;P&gt;The Fit Line, etc. can then be run.&amp;nbsp; By holding down the CNTL key as you select Fit Line or any of the other options, the selection will be run on all graphs.&lt;/P&gt;
